ABSTRACT
We report the implantation of the Berlin Heart EXCOR (Berlin Heart, Berlin, Germany) as a pediatric biventricular assist device in a 10-month-old boy with primary graft failure after cardiac transplantation. The EXCOR was successfully used as a bridge to cardiac retransplantation. The pneumatically driven paracorporeal device supported the patient for 165 days until another suitable heart was obtained.
